Data Structures | |
| class | Mutex |
| The Mutex class is used to synchronize the execution of threads. More... | |
Functions | |
| Mutex () | |
| Create and Initialize a Mutex object. More... | |
| Mutex (const char *name) | |
| Create and Initialize a Mutex object. More... | |
| ~Mutex () | |
| Mutex destructor. More... | |
| void | lock () |
| Wait until a Mutex becomes available. More... | |
| bool | trylock () |
| Try to lock the mutex, and return immediately. More... | |
| bool | trylock_for (uint32_t millisec) |
| Try to lock the mutex for a specified time. More... | |
| bool | trylock_until (uint64_t millisec) |
| Try to lock the mutex until specified time. More... | |
| void | unlock () |
| Unlock the mutex that has previously been locked by the same thread. More... | |
